4.4 CERAMIC PARTS
- ceramic reflector – is installed on the surface of the burner
- ceramic extension grate – is installed into the boiler body over the burner furnace
- ceramic schield – is installed over the door
- ceramic facing door – is mantled on the door
4.5 FEEDER 1 WITH INDEPENDENT DRIVE (FROM FUEL BIN)
Fuel feeder number 1 consisting of a driven ribbon flight and a tube transport route including the overflow
part.
This feeder is built into the fuel bin under an angle which may not exceed 45°. If the position of the feeder
is more perpendicular, dosing of fuel is not precise.
The feeder has its own drive which is controlled by the control unit.
The feeder is supplied in a standard length equal to 140 cm.
The feeder 1 consists of the following parts:
- body of the feeder with flanges
- spiral – chute feeder 1 with an electric motor with a gearbox
- flexible hose to feeder 2
- pulse sensor of feeders
4.6 JACKETING OF THE BOILER INCLUDING HEAT INSULATION
Jacket of the product is made from sheet steel, is coated with a heavy-duty COMAXITE COATING which is
perfectly resistant to environment effects and ensures perfect appearance of products on long-term basis.
